Is Chippenham Monkton a good place to live?

Chippenham Monkton may be a good fit for people who value lower crime, stronger school performance and stronger transport access. It ranks strongly for lower crime, stronger school performance and stronger transport access, while flood risk is around the national middle range. The public data does not show a single obvious weak signal among the available headline measures.
